How to Make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ps
Ingredients:
- 2 cups cooked chicken (shredded)
- 1/2 cup garlic aioli
- 1 cup cheddar cheese (shredded)
- 4 large tortillas
- Salt and pepper to taste
Directions:
- In a mixing bowl, combine the shredded chicken, garlic aioli, salt, and pepper. Mix well until the chicken is fully coated.
- Place the tortillas on a clean surface.
- Divide the chicken mixture evenly among the tortillas.
-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ese over each tortilla filled with the chicken mixture.
- Fold in the sides of the tortilla and then roll it up from the bottom to the top to create a wrap.
-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at. Place the wraps seam-side down in the skillet and cook for 2 to 3 minutes on each side until golden brown and the cheese has melted.
- Remove from the skillet and slice in half before serving.

How to Store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ps
If you have leftovers, wrap them tightly in plastic wrap or place them in an airtight container. Keep them in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, you can use the microwave or a skillet until warmed through.

FAQs
Can I use store-bought rotisserie chicken for this recipe?
Yes, rotisserie chicken works great for this recipe and saves time.
Can I freeze Cheesy Garlic Chicken Wraps?
Yes, you can freeze the wraps. Just make sure to wrap them well and store them in a freezer-safe container. Thaw before reheating.
What type of tortillas should I use?
You can use any large tortillas you prefer, including flour, whole wheat, or corn tortillas.
